- Signal strength
-
Network indicator
Red: no network
Blue: 3G/LTE
White: 5G -
WiFi indicator
On: WiFi is on
Flashing: WPS is on - Power indicator
- WPS button
- Antenna connector
- Network port
- Power connector
- Reset button and Nano SIM slot
Connecting to MTN 5G
- Insert the MTN 5G Nano SIM into the SIM slot.
- Connect the power supply.
- Switch on the router and wait for 10 minutes to allow the SIM to activate.
- Restart the router by switching it off, waiting for 1 minute, and switching it on again.
- Connect your device (PC, laptop, smartphone, etc.) to the router with a cable or via Wifi. The WiFi details are are printed on sticker next to the SIM slot.
- Once connected, open your browser, and browse to the address https://192.168.8.1/
